Volleyball Recap: Centennial Spartans vs. Joshua Owls

Centennial came tearing into Friday's game with six straight wins and they left with even more momentum. They came out on top in a nail-biter against the Joshua Owls , sneaking past 3-2. This was payback for the Spartans, who suffered a 3-2 defeat the last time these two teams met.

Centennial was actually outscored in aggregate across those five sets (108-104), but they still managed to win.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 17-25, 27-25, 25-23, 20-25, 15-10.

Kallie Connelly gave her former team something to remember she by as she had 22 digs and two aces for Centennial. The dominant performance gave Connelly a new career-high in aces.

Centennial has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won nine of their last ten matchups, which provided a nice bump to their 26-7 record this season. As for Joshua, the loss snapped their winning streak at six games and leaves them with a 20-13 record.

Centennial will take on Burleson at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Both teams are headed into the matchup with plenty of momentum (Centennial has won 15 straight at home dating back to last season, while Burleson won five straight on the road), something that'll have to change. As for Joshua, they will square off against Everman at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Joshua is facing Everman at the right time seeing as Everman is stuck on a four-game losing streak.
